Get In Touch
GLOBAL DELIVERY CENTER
1'st Floor, Arcadian, 31/2/1,
BLD NO.12, North Road, Koregaon Park,
Pune, Maharashtra, India, 411001.
Back

How to Conduct a Technical Interview for Remote Developers in 2025

Remote work is no longer a trend—it’s the new normal. In 2025, most tech companies are hiring developers who work from home or anywhere across the globe. However, hiring remote developers requires a different approach. You can’t rely on in-person meetings—you need smart, effective ways to evaluate skills virtually. This guide will show you how to conduct a technical interview for remote developers in 2025 using simple steps and easy-to-use tools. Let’s dive in.

Understanding the Remote Work Landscape in 2025

Remote work has become standard across the tech industry. Companies are now building global teams and tapping into talent from any location.

Quick facts:

  • Over 80% of tech teams offer fully remote roles.

  • Tools like Zoom, Slack, and GitHub are now core to daily workflows.

  • AI is helping screen and assess candidates.

  • Live coding platforms make real-time skill evaluation possible.

  • Soft skills are as important as hard skills.

This shift means interviews must also evolve to be smooth, unbiased, and tech-friendly.

Preparing for the Remote Technical Interview

Step 1: Understand the Job Role
List the exact skills required, such as JavaScript, data structures, or team collaboration.

Step 2: Create a Standardised Process
Use the same interview questions and tests for all candidates to ensure fairness.

Step 3: Choose the Right Tools
Select user-friendly platforms for communication, coding, and collaboration:

  • Video Calls: Zoom, Google Meet

  • Coding Tests: CoderPad, HackerRank

  • Team Chat: Slack, Microsoft Teams

Preparation is key to a successful technical interview, especially in a remote setup.

See also: Top 12 Remote Hiring Mistakes to Avoid for Remote Developers

Key Components of a Remote Technical Interview

a) Evaluating Technical Skills

Ask candidates to solve live coding challenges using platforms that allow real-time collaboration.

Also, request GitHub links or project samples to review their previous work.

b) Assessing Soft Skills and Culture Fit

It’s not just about writing good code. A great remote developer also needs communication and teamwork skills.

Ask questions like:

  • “How do you collaborate with remote teams?”

  • “What’s your approach when you hit a roadblock?”

c) Testing Problem-Solving and Critical Thinking

Give them real-world problems that your team faces. Let them walk you through their approach to solving it.

This gives you a window into how they think, plan, and execute.

Using Technology to Enhance the Interview Experience

Remote interviews can feel impersonal, but the right tools make a big difference.

  • Use pair programming tools to simulate real collaboration.

  • Record video responses for asynchronous screening.

  • Offer flexible scheduling for different time zones.

  • Always test your setup before the call to avoid technical glitches.

After the Interview: What to Do Next

The interview is just one part of the process. Post-interview steps matter, too.

  • Gather interviewer feedback using scorecards.

  • Collect candidate feedback to improve your process.

  • Verify references or do a background check.

  • Make a decision based on a balanced view of technical, soft, and cultural fit.

See also: Where to Hire a Website Developer – Top Platforms & Tips

Common Challenges (and How to Handle Them)

Tech Glitches?
Have a backup—switch to phone calls or chats if video fails.

Unfair Judgments?
Use structured scorecards. Give each candidate equal time and attention.

Poor Communication?
Set expectations early—clearly outline the process, number of rounds, duration, and interviewers.

Structuring the Interview for Better Flow

A remote interview needs a clear structure to keep things on track and reduce confusion.

Break the interview into segments like:

  • Intro & Warm-up (5-10 mins): Small talk to make the candidate comfortable.

  • Technical Assessment (20-30 mins): Live coding or system design.

  • Behavioural Questions (10-15 mins): Assess communication and teamwork.

  • Wrap-Up & Q&A (5-10 mins): Let the candidate ask questions.

This flow helps both sides stay focused and ensures that nothing important is missed.

Creating a Great Candidate Experience

Even if you’re hiring remotely, candidate experience matters. A smooth process builds your brand and increases acceptance rates.

To create a positive experience:

  • Send clear instructions before the interview.

  • Be on time and respectful of their schedule.

  • Offer feedback after the interview—even if they’re not selected.

Remember, every candidate is a potential ambassador for your company.

Involving the Right Interviewers

The people conducting the interview are just as important as the questions.

Choose interviewers who:

  • Understand the technical requirements of the role.

  • Can evaluate soft skills and culture fit.

  • Represent your company values and remote culture.

Train interviewers to stay consistent and avoid bias, especially in remote interviews.

See also: Future of Remote Work: Hiring Remote Developers

Tracking and Improving Your Interview Process

Don’t just set your process once—keep refining it.

Create a simple tracking system where you collect:

  • Interview outcomes

  • Candidate feedback

  • Interviewer notes

  • Time-to-hire metrics

Use this data to find bottlenecks or areas for improvement. A well-tracked process becomes better over time and results in smarter hiring decisions.

Conclusion

Remote hiring is the future—and it’s already here.
When you know how to conduct a remote technical interview the right way, you can attract and hire top-tier global talent.

Start with a clear plan. Use effective tools. Focus on both technical skills and human connection.

Keep improving your process and stay open to feedback.

Have tips or tools you use for remote interviews? Share them in the comments—we’d love to hear from you!